Deadlock singer Sabine Scherer recently decided to exit the band in order to focus on her family life. She revealed her departure and her subsequent replacement, Margie Gerlitz, in the below video statement. With that big change out of the way, the band have also now announced that their new album, “Hybris“, will be released on July 08th through Napalm. Guitarist Sebastian Reichl commented:
“‘Hybris‘ is both powerlessness and hope, melancholia and confidence united, accounting for the past in the truest sense. The effort to meet your demons, to forgive and to find salvation with your own history. The release of dammed aggressions and wash away all fears. Put all wrath and anger in music and lyrics to fill with new passion. This is all what ‘Hybris‘ symbolizes and you can feel it every second on the album. It was our longest trip. Giving up was never an option.”
The track listing and cover art for the release can be found below. A 90-minute DVD chronicling the album’s conception—from writing to recording—will come with select editions of the album.
